Position Summary
West Bend Health and Rehabilitation invites applications for a Speech-Language Pathologist position in our rehabilitation department. This is an exciting opportunity to join a dynamic team dedicated to delivering exceptional care and improving patient outcomes.
Responsibilities
- Assess and treat patients with various communication disorders
-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to coordinate patient care
- Develop and implement individualized treatment plans based on patient needs and goals
- Communicate effectively with patients, families, and healthcare professionals
Requirements
-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ology or a related field
- Current licensure/certification in the state of practice
- Minimum one year of experience in a similar setting (desired)
